Abstract
Numerical simulation of 3D unsteady flow dynamics in a blood vessel with multiple aneurysms was performed. Computational studies were also carried out to understand the influence of parameters like Reynolds number, Strouhal number, etc. The low axial flow velocities were noticed under the hull of the aneurysm during the entire flow cycle.
